
AArch32 code (ie traditional 32 bit world) expects to be able to pass a vaddr in a TCGv_i32. However when QEMU is compiled with TARGET_LONG_BITS=32 the TCG load/store functions take a TCGv_i64. Abstract out load/store with a 32 bit vaddr so we have a place to put the zero extension of the vaddr and the extension/truncation of the data value. Apart from the function definitions most of this patch is a simple s/tcg_gen_qemu_/gen_aa32_/.
